Indulge in the world of Jim Mullen, a true luminary in the realm of jazz guitar, as we bring you an exceptional musical experience on this channel. Hailing from Glasgow, Mullen's virtuosity has earned him a revered place among Europe's most distinguished jazz guitarists, a sentiment echoed by Jazzwise, labelling him as "one of today's preeminent jazz guitarists."
Recipient of numerous accolades, including the prestigious Honorary Parliamentary Jazz Award in 2017, Mullen's legacy is etched through his illustrious collaborations and solo endeavors. His musical journey has intertwined with iconic bands of the '70s and '80s, such as Brian Auger's "Oblivion Express," The Average White Band, and his own highly acclaimed jazz-funk sensation "Morrissey-Mullen."
In this exclusive presentation, Jim Mullen takes the lead alongside accomplished British pianist and organist Mike Gorman and the rhythmic finesse of drummer Matt Home. Together, they delve into the classic Organ trio format, delivering an electrifying set that seamlessly weaves original compositions and carefully chosen jazz standards. The result is a captivating blend of groove-infused hard-bop, a harmonious meeting point of tradition and innovation.

A very long time ago (1969?), I used to frequent a cellar pub in Glasgow called Burns Howff. The house band were called Power & featured Maggie Bell on vocals, Les Harvey (brother of Alex Harvey) on guitar with Jim Dewar on bass & vocals. Keyboard & drummer I don't recall. Towards the middle of the set this giant, skinny guy with black bushy hair would saunter on to the tiny stage & play what looked like a toy guitar in this weird style, just using his thumb. Once seen, Jim Mullen was unforgettable. Nice to see him doing what he loves.
